Page 36 - 4366
P. 36
ЛЕКЦІЯ 6
ОРГАНІЗАЦІЯ МАСИВІВ У LABVIEW
ФУНКЦІЇ ДЛЯ РОБОТИ З МАСИВАМИ
Масив (Array) - це набір даних одного і того ж типу.
Масиви можуть бути різної розмірності, на кожну розмірність
31
припадає максимум 2 -1 элементів.
Можна створити масив з даних типів: numeric, Boolean,
path, string, waveform, і cluster. Не можна створити масив з
масивів, проте можна зробити cluster (про кластери буде
детально розказано далі).
Елементи в масиві впорядковані, кожен з них має
порядковий номер (index), нумерація елементів починається з
нуля.
Щоб створити масив візуальних компонентів, виберіть
"Array" в палітрі «Controls->all Controls->Array & Cluster» і
помістіть його на лицьову панель. Утвориться порожній
нетипизований масив, що має вигляд рамки, потім всередину
рамки масиву помістіть елемент потрібного типу.
Щоб змінити розмірність масиву, слід вибрати в його
контекстному меню "Add Dimension" – для додавання ще
однієї розмірності, або "Remove Dimension". Як вже
говорилося, двовимірний масив - це таблиця. Щоб
відображення масиву було наочнішим, можна розтягнути
область елементів до потрібного розміру, та слід мати на увазі,
що розмірність масиву і кількість елементів в ньому не
визначаються виглядом масиву на лицьовій панелі (наприклад,
в того ж двовимірного масиву можна зробити зону елементів
такою, що складається лише з одного видимого). Тому, як
правило, для масивів невеликих розмірів намагаються
забезпечити відображення на передній панелі всього масиву.
Так само, можна додати на блок-діаграму масив-константу
(це може бути корисно, наприклад, для передачі даних у
35